Also known as tension or expansion springs, extension springs are tightly wound coils that create tension when a load or force is applied to their ends, causing them to extend. These springs usually feature hooks, loops, or end coils, which are often the weakest points. In high-force applications, replacing hooks with bolts can prevent bending or breaking, thereby increasing the spring's durability and reliability. Extension springs are used in devices where a force pulls apart the spring from its original length, such as trampolines, push and pull levers, rocking horses, and screen doors. The primary function of an extension spring is to provide extended force when stretched and to return to its original position when the force is removed.
Small compression springs are used extensively in diverse sectors. In the automotive industry, they provide critical functions in sensors, throttle valves, and suspension systems. In consumer electronics, they can be found in devices like remote controls, keyboards, and cameras, where space is limited but reliable performance is required. Additionally, they play a vital role in medical devices, helping maintain functionality in equipment such as automated dispensers and monitoring devices.

The spiral wires in compression springs are not touching when in a relaxed position and only become so under the stress of weight. In contrast, extension springs are designed so that their spiral wires are contiguous when there is no weight load and stretched apart under the stress of a weighted load. Coil springs can be made of various steel materials, including stainless spring steel hard drawn spring steel, steel music wire, and oil-tempered spring steel. Spring steel is a special kind of steel with increased elasticity and return properties. The elasticity of a spring enables it to return to its original position; however, this capability diminishes with use. In general, the larger the wire, the stronger the spring is.
